What Is Notability?

Notability is a powerful digital note-taking app designed primarily for audio-supported handwritten notes. It is especially popular among students, lecturers, and professionals who attend meetings or classes and want to combine writing with voice recordings.

Meaning & Purpose

Notability allows users to:

  • Write with Apple Pencil ✏️
  • Type text
  • Import PDFs and slides
  • Record audio synced with notes

Its standout feature is audio recording linked to handwriting, meaning you can tap on a word and hear exactly what was said when you wrote it.

Short History & Usage Note

Notability was released in 2010 and quickly became a favorite in academia. Its focus has always been simplicity, speed, and audio integration, rather than heavy customization.


What Is GoodNotes?

GoodNotes is a feature-rich digital notebook app built for organization, customization, and long-term note management. It is ideal for users who want their digital notes to feel like real, structured notebooks.

Meaning & Purpose

GoodNotes allows users to:

  • Create multiple notebooks
  • Customize paper styles 📓
  • Use advanced folders
  • Annotate PDFs
  • Plan schedules and journals

Unlike Notability, GoodNotes does not focus on audio recording. Instead, it emphasizes clean layouts and organization.

Short History & Usage Note

GoodNotes gained massive popularity after GoodNotes 5, when it introduced smoother handwriting and better organization. It is often praised for replacing physical notebooks entirely.

Key Differences Between Notability and GoodNotes

Quick Summary Points

  • Notability focuses on audio + notes
  • GoodNotes focuses on structure and customization
  • Notability is faster and simpler
  • GoodNotes is more detailed and organized
  • Both support Apple Pencil
  • Both annotate PDFs, but differently

Comparison Table

FeatureNotabilityGoodNotes
Primary FocusAudio-linked notesStructured notebooks
Audio Recording✅ Yes (core feature)❌ No
OrganizationBasicAdvanced
Custom TemplatesLimitedExtensive
Best ForLectures & meetingsStudy & planning
Learning CurveEasyModerate
File StructureFlat notesNotebook + folders
Planner SupportLimitedExcellent
Price ModelSubscriptionOne-time (varies)

Conclusion

The debate between Notability or GoodNotes isn’t about which app is better — it’s about which app fits your workflow. Notability shines when you need audio-supported, fast note-taking, especially in lectures and meetings. GoodNotes excels in organization, customization, and long-term planning. Both are powerful, reliable, and widely trusted in 2026. If you prefer simplicity and recordings, choose Notability. If you value structure and creativity, choose GoodNotes.
